Now you want to run higher boost in your 6.4L Powerstroke, or maybe you're looking to move your power band further up the RPM range on your 6.0L with a new camshaft, you're going to want to replace your valve springs to a set designed to hold your valves closed when they need to be closed, but still able to open when necessary. In a situation with the purchase of a new camshaft, the cam card will dictate the recommended spring ratings to ensure you get the maximum performance out of the cam without floating valves.

Manton provides a full 32 spring set of high boost and high rev ready valve springs with 123lbs of seat pressure over the factory 80lbs, and 284lbs of open pressure. With that, you can feel confident that your valve train will open and close as it should, and not be a hinderance to your performance build.

Valve float can be a problem for those with high boost builds and higher RPM performance in the 2003-2010 Ford 6.0 and 6.4L Powerstroke, or for those with very little backpressure from the exhaust from hood stacks with large diameter piping. Valve float is exactly as it sounds, instead of fully closing during the engines cycle, the valve springs do not have enough force to hold the valve closed and thus, the valve "floats". You may see a dip in RPM, hear the engine stumble, or in extreme cases, find bent push rods during a tear down. You may experience a rattle in the valve train as well, which could be an indication of pending failure.
